Heerenveen gets 2-1 win on road PSV Eindhoven falls out of first place with lossPosted: Saturday August 29, 1998 05:38 PM AMSTERDAM, Netherlands (AP) -- Ajax Amsterdam seized its second victory of the new season Friday, downing Roda JC Kerkrade 2-0 with a little help from Roda's Australian goalkeeper Zeljko Kalac. After a messy first half Ajax winger Peter Hoekstra broke the deadlock on 56 minutes after Kalac rushed out to claim a corner but misjudged his jump and was left groping helplessly for the ball. Roda created some chances but wasted them with wild shooting and Tijani Babangida decided the game in Ajax's favor with just seven minutes left on the clock. The tiny Nigerian winger had recovered all his pace after a recent injury layoff, and his acceleration near the righthand corner of the penalty area left Roda deenders standing. Babangida's dipping near-post drive caught Kalac again out of position and he could only parry the ball into his own net. Champion Ajax now heads the Dutch premiership with six points from two games but all the other sides play their second matches Saturday and Sunday.
